Freshness

You can brew fresh ground beans by using a coffeemaker equipped with a grinder. Contrary to pre-ground coffee, which has already been sitting in a can or bag for some time freshly ground beans have a much more intense flavor and aroma. The size of the grind can be adjusted to meet your preferences. This is crucial, since different methods of brewing call for different grind sizes. For example, french press coffee requires more coarse grind than espresso.

A grinder on its own can be noisy and add an additional step to the making coffee. This is why grinder-equipped coffee makers are extremely popular. They can save you lots of time and effort, and they're more silent than the majority of kinds of instant coffee machines.

In our tests of the top coffee makers, we've seen that those with integrated grinders can make a cup coffee that's as good or even better than those that don't have one. This is because the beans are ground just before brewing so they're fresh. Many coffee makers that include a grinder also come with adjustable grind settings, so you can achieve the right consistency and flavor.

Another feature to look for in a machine with grinder is the type of grind that is used. The best choice is a burr grinder. The burr grinder utilizes two rotating abrasive surfaces to crush beans to create uniform, consistent grounds. It is considered superior than blade grinders that just chop up the beans. Uncoordinated grinding can result in uneven extraction and small coffee machines a bitter flavor in your coffee.
